Taxonomic Classification

Rank Malayan Free-tailed Bat Rio Tuquesa Treefrog
Kingdom same Animalia (животные) Animalia (животные)
Phylum same Chordata (хордовые) Chordata (хордовые)
Class Mammalia (млекопитающие) Amphibia (земноводные)
Order Chiroptera (рукокрылые) Anura (бесхвостые земноводные)
Family Molossidae Hylidae
Genus Mops Dendropsophus
Species Mops mops Dendropsophus subocularis

Evolutionary Relationship

Malayan Free-tailed Bat and Rio Tuquesa Treefrog share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(хордовые)
